What happens to your document
What we read
The numbers on the sheet: prices, fees, tax, APR, and what the vehicle is. That is all the scan looks for.
What we never keep
The photo or PDF itself. It lives in memory for one read, then it is gone. It is never written to a disk, a database, or anyone's storage bucket.
What we never store
Names, addresses, signatures, phone numbers, or anything else personal that appears on the paperwork. If you email yourself a report, we send it once and forget the address.
The VIN
Kept internally only, to catch duplicate submissions. It never appears in public, and you will only ever see the last six characters of it.
Contributions
Nothing enters the public record unless you tick the box after a signed-deal scan. Skip the box and the numbers vanish with the document.
What this is not
Automata reads documents and does math. It is not legal or financial advice.
